I’m looking for proven tactics to boost visibility for my Vue-friendly npm package that streamlines loading screens. Should I focus on creating tutorials, writing articles, or engaging in relevant communities?
Based on my personal experience marketing a similar package, a balanced approach works best. While tutorials effectively demonstrate functionality and real-world use-cases, engaging actively in developer communities has proven essential. Contributing to discussions on popular platforms and promptly addressing inquiries established credibility and trust among users. I found that writing detailed articles was effective in explaining technical advantages, yet nothing beats genuine interactions within communities. These discussions not only drive visibility but also provide constructive feedback for iterative improvements.
My experience marketing an npm package started by taking a consistent, hands-on approach. I began by updating and improving documentation continuously, making it easy for new users to get started even without extensive background knowledge. Alongside writing helpful blog posts that detailed both basic usage and advanced features, I engaged in live Q&A sessions and answered support questions directly. This helped amplify user trust and organically grew the community. Over time, combining steady content creation with proactive user engagement built a solid base of users and advocates.
hey, in my exp, rough vid demos combined with quick interactive posts in slack & discord works wonders. also try a simplest blog mention; it got traction for me. ppl like examples that feel real, not too overcooked. sometimes less is more, ya know?
In my experience, a diversified approach where you consistently engage with both potential users and the broader development ecosystem works best. I started by updating the documentation to ensure clarity and ease of integration, while also creating scenario-based tutorials that addressed real-world problems. Additionally, I established a presence in community forums and technical groups to both share updates and receive valuable feedback. Collaborating with tech bloggers to highlight use-cases further boosted its visibility. This method of offering clear technical insights and actively listening to user feedback has proven sustainable in maintaining interest and growth over time.
In my experience, combining technical documentation improvements with strategic collaborations can make a significant difference. I spent time refining detailed API examples on GitHub and ensuring the documentation was as up-to-date as possible. Engaging with industry influencers and advocating for the value added by my package during tech meetups and webinars enhanced its reputation. Furthermore, I integrated user feedback cycles into the development process, which not only improved the package but also built a loyal user base. These efforts worked together to raise awareness in a crowded ecosystem.